Exclusive. Elite. Always Discreet: Welcome to the Billionaires Club.
In the second installment of The Billionaires Club quartet, arrogant tycoon Sebastian Dumont risks everything for one night with an exquisite dancer - whose dark fantasy leaves him wanting more.
Love is a risk I will never take, a prize too good for a man who betrayed his family. That’s why I prefer to keep things transactional. So when I see an exquisite dancer in the exclusive Parisian billionaires club, turning her burlesque into an erotic art form, I’ll give whatever it takes to have her…
She is mine for one night, to do with as I please. But following my commands seems to bring her as much pleasure as it does me. And I can’t help wondering at her performance. She almost makes me believe this is a fantasy of her own making.
I’m not ready to let her go after just one night, but I never imagined my hunt would lead me to New York City, or to a restrained and disciplined ballerina. Stoking the fire that rages between us could be the biggest risk I’ve ever taken…one that may cost me everything, including my damaged heart.

I really loved this steamy romance. Caitlin Crews is one of my favourite authors and she really delivered sizzle in spades in this story. In my opinion this was excellent writing and you could feel the H/h's connection as soon as their eyes met. while she was dancing at the M Club. They had one stolen night of fantasy together. CEO Sebastian with his own reasons and ballet dancer Darcy with her own. Neither could forget the other even months later. The erotic scenes were steamy, romantic and sensual and I didn't want to put the book down. This is probably the best Mills and Boon 'Dare' I have read so far and the scene with the wings was something different - also, the characterization was very believable and in depth. I do recommend this book. 4.5 stars!

This book was pretty good and this is one of my favorite authors. Sebastian was rich, handsome and sexy as hell but he had issues with a half brother and an alcoholic mother. Darcy was a ballerina with secret desires that she was going to have taken care of tonight. She was going to do a dance at a certain gentleman’s club and then play. Sebastian sat in the front and he was mesmerized by her and she danced only for him. At the end of the dance she let him buy her for the evening and after that he wanted more and she said no, fantasy over?! I loved that they made each other not just whole but better. Their families were also made better, it was well done. I really enjoyed this book and read it in one day.
